WebJan 1, 2015 · Poly (phenylene oxide) (PPO), which is sometimes called poly (phenylene ether) (PPE), and poly (phenylene sulfide) (PPS) are practically important and widely used as high performance engineering plastics. The synthetic reactions of both belong to a typical type of condensation polymerization via step-growth pathways.
